fix issue: #897, ugly memo in payments list
Fixes: #897

memo is now a 1 liner
before

Codecov Report
Merging #918 (fccc6bb) into main (ae1a2ac) will not change coverage. The diff coverage is
n/a.
@@ Coverage Diff @@
## main #918 +/- ##
=======================================
Coverage 51.84% 51.84%
=======================================
Files 225 225
Lines 12351 12351
=======================================
Hits 6403 6403
Misses 5948 5948
:mega: We’re building smart automated test selection to slash your CI/CD build times. Learn more
another addition, don' t use columns for payment-details
before

after

i leave this pr as is, i think its subjectively better than before, but i do not want get into any design discussion :).
thats a long phone you have there!
Can you test and post images from a mobile device.
Be good to get this merged, but it needs compacting for a smaller screen Add some v-if="gt-md", or something similar to some padding elements to tuck it all in 👍.